Communicating in Canada's Past Essays in Media History
Allen, Gene; Robinson, Daniel J. (eds.) Publisher: University of Toronto Press, Canada Year Published: 2009 Pages: 272pp Price: $29.95 ISBN: 978-0-8020-9498-8 Address sizable gaps in the literature on media history in Canada. Includes a substantial introduction to media history as a field of study and essays on a range of subjects, including print journalism, radio, television, and advertising. Subject Headings
